Noun
project (plural: projects)
- A planned endeavor, usually with a specific goal and accomplished in several steps or stages.
- An urban low-income housing building.

Intransitive verb
project (projects, projected, projecting)
- to extend beyond a surface.

Transitive verb
project (projects, projected, projecting)
- to cast (an image or shadow) upon a surface.
- to extend (a protrusion or appendage) outward.
- to make plans for; to forecast
